Understanding Football Betting Stake

It is important to carefully consider your stake as it directly impacts the potential return on your investment. The stake can vary depending on your confidence level in a bet, the odds offered, and your overall betting strategy.

In football betting, it is common for bettors to allocate a certain percentage of their betting bankroll as their stake for each bet. This approach helps in managing risk and preventing excessive losses. By determining an appropriate stake size, you can protect your bankroll from being depleted by one or two losing bets. It is essential to strike a balance between a stake size that is substantial enough to yield profitable returns but not too high that it puts your bankroll at unnecessary risk.

The Importance of Bankroll Management in Football Betting

Effective bankroll management is crucial for success in football betting. It involves setting aside a specific sum of money designated solely for placing bets. By establishing this separate bankroll, bettors can allocate funds strategically and avoid the risk of overspending or chasing losses. This disciplined approach allows for consistent betting and ensures that emotions don’t dictate wagering decisions.

When it comes to bankroll management, it is essential to determine a staking plan that aligns with your risk tolerance and betting goals. This plan should dictate how much of your bankroll you are willing to risk on each wager. By sticking to a predetermined staking strategy, bettors can protect their capital and withstand inevitable losing streaks without depleting their funds too quickly. Ultimately, implementing a sound bankroll management strategy can enhance long-term profitability and sustainability in football betting.
